given the circle below with chords \\( \overline { u v } \\) and \\( \overline { w x } \\). find the length of \\( \overline { w y } \\). round to the nearest tenth if necessary.

Explanation:

Step1: Apply the Chord - Chord Product Theorem

If two chords \(UV\) and \(WX\) intersect at a point \(Y\) inside a circle, then \(UY\times VY=WY\times XY\).
Let \(WY = x\). We know that \(UY = 10\), \(VY=5\), and \(XY = 9\).
The equation from the theorem is \(10\times5=x\times9\).

Step2: Solve for \(x\)

From \(10\times5=x\times9\), we have \(50 = 9x\).
Then \(x=\frac{50}{9}\approx5.6\)

Answer:

\(5.6\)
